    About This Project

    Biodiversity surveys often overlook fungi despite their importance. California’s Fungal Diversity Survey is changing this, but habitats like vernal pool grasslands are not yet well-surveyed. My project asks: what fungi occur at the vernal pools of the Jepson Prairie Preserve? I expects its diversity to mirror other grasslands, but there may be unique species. I will collect voucher specimens to generate baseline data for the preserve and provide insight on grassland fungi across the state.
